Jurrjens invited for Spring Training Camp
Curacao native Jair Jurrjens who signed a Minor League deal with the Colorado Rockies in November, has received an invitation to the Rockies Spring Training Camp in Arizona.
After a long absence he had a rocky start (sorry for the pun) with the Rockies. In two starts he went 0-1 with a 10.61 ERA. After this short stint he was sent down to AAA Colorado Springs (now a Brewers affiliation). It is very likely that Jurrjens will start the season at AAA Albuquerque.
Jurrjens started his MLB career with the Tigers in 2007 before he was traded to Atlanta. With the Braves he had his best years before he was hit by the injury bug. Since 2011 he hasn’t pitched a complete MLB season.
